On this day, April 9, in 1942 the USAFFE forces led by Gen. Edward P King Jr. surrendered to the Japanese. In 1961 passed RA No. 3022 designates April 9 of every year as Bataan Day. In 1983, EO No. 203 called it the Day of Bravery. RA No. 9492 s2007 Bravery Day was moved to April 9 or the closest Monday to this date.

On this day in 1959, NASA announced the selection of America’s first seven astronauts, Gordon Cooper, Wally Schirra, Alan Shepard, Gus Grissom, John Glenn, Donald Slayton, and Scott Carpenter.
